Budapest is a vibrant city with a rich history, stunning architecture, and a lively nightlife scene. Here’s a fun and engaging 2-day itinerary for your Sunday and Monday adventure, focusing on both daytime exploration and nighttime partying!

## Day 1: Sunday - Exploring the City and Nightlife Kickoff

Morning:

  • Breakfast at New York Café: Start your day at the iconic New York Café, often dubbed the most beautiful café in the world. Enjoy a delicious Hungarian pastry and a strong coffee while soaking in the opulent atmosphere.

Late Morning:

Afternoon:

  • Lunch at the Great Market Hall: Head to the Great Market Hall for lunch. Try some traditional Hungarian dishes like goulash or lángos (fried flatbread). Don’t forget to grab some paprika or local wines as souvenirs!

  • Visit Buda Castle: Cross the Danube River to the Buda side and explore Buda Castle. The views from Fisherman’s Bastion are breathtaking, especially on a sunny day. Snap some photos and enjoy the scenery!

Evening:

  • Dinner at a Ruin Bar: For dinner, head to one of Budapest’s famous ruin bars, like Szimpla Kert. These eclectic bars are set in abandoned buildings and courtyards, offering a unique atmosphere. Grab some street food from the market inside and enjoy a drink.

Night:

  • Party at Instant: After dinner, make your way to Instant, one of the largest ruin bars in Budapest. With multiple rooms and a variety of music styles, it’s a great place to dance the night away. The vibrant atmosphere and eclectic crowd will keep you entertained!

## Day 2: Monday - Relaxation and Nightlife Finale

Morning:

  • Brunch at Café Gerbeaud: Start your Monday with a leisurely brunch at Café Gerbeaud, one of the oldest and most famous cafés in Budapest. Indulge in some sweet treats and a hearty breakfast.

Late Morning:

  • Relax at Széchenyi Thermal Bath: After brunch, head to Széchenyi Thermal Bath, one of the largest medicinal baths in Europe. Spend a few hours soaking in the thermal waters and enjoying the beautiful architecture. It’s a perfect way to relax and recharge!

Afternoon:

Evening:

  • Dinner at a Traditional Hungarian Restaurant: For your last dinner in Budapest, try a traditional Hungarian restaurant like Paprika or Menza. Savor dishes like stuffed cabbage or chicken paprikash.

Night:

  • Clubbing at Akvárium Klub: End your trip with a bang at Akvárium Klub, a popular club located in the heart of the city. With a mix of local and international DJs, you’ll find a lively atmosphere and great music to dance to.

  • Late-Night Snack: If you’re feeling peckish after dancing, grab a late-night snack at one of the many food stalls or eateries nearby. A kebab or a slice of pizza will hit the spot!
